Ride Around Turtle Island

For all those who enjoy cycling.

Style is _UKES140.STY (Folk Swing w/ Ukulele )

RealTracks in style: ~1137:Bass, Acoustic-Guitar, FolkSwing Sw 140
RealTracks in song: ~559:Guitar, Acoustic, Rhythm Jazz Freddie Sw 140 ('A' only)
RealTracks in style: ~1143:Ukulele, Strumming FolkSwing Sw 140
RealTracks in song: 2855:Harmonica, Background CountrySwingJellyRoll Sw 120
RealDrums in style: NashvilleBrushesHillbillySwing: a: Sidestick, Brushesb: Brushes, Stick
Thanks to Floyd for the handclap loop.
